WATER AND SANITATION Principal Professional Officer


Requirements:


  • BTech or degree in Civil Engineering
  • Professional registration will serve as an advantage
  • At least eight (8) years appropriate experience, involving
sound working knowledge of relevant legislation, policy

and procedures, including contract administration (GCC)

and staff management

  • Good ver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to lead and think independently; provide strategic
direction; and effectively and efficiently organise, analyse,

set goals, administer, guide, integrate and implement systems,

plans, standards and procedures

  • Proficiency and competency in MS Excel, MS Word, MS
PowerPoint and SharePoint

  • A valid driver's licence with own reliable transport and the ability
to travel extensively to city sites

Key Performance Areas

  • Respond to enquiries and requests, report writing, compile
presentations and record keeping

  • Communicate with internal and external clients, i.e.
colleagues, clients, councillors, developers, etc.

  • Water distribution network analysis and performance assessments
  • Monitor and assess operational efficiencies in the water
distribution system and pressure management zones towards

extending asset lifespan and reduce supply disruptions

  • Project management, including needs analysis, feasibility,
scoping, technical specification, procurement, implementation,

administration and close out for network upgrades,

rehabilitation and replacements

  • Assessment and recommendations for approval of development
  • Implementation, monitoring and compliance to Service Level
Agreements

  • Corporate and statutory compliance
  • Supervision, including work allocation and performance
management

of reporting staff
